WebJun 15, 2024 · Grill the chicken halves. Prepare the charcoal grill for direct cooking over medium heat (180-220 degrees Celsius/ 350- 430 degrees Fahrenheit). Place the meat, skin side down, over direct medium heat (8). Close with the lid and cook for 5 to 10 minutes, until the skin releases easily from the grill grates and is golden. Start shopping online now with Instacart to get your favorite products on-demand. fallout 1 speedrun guideWebSep 8, 2024 · Step Five: Place the two half chickens skin side down on the grill and let it cook for 20 minutes. Step Six: Turn them over and cook with the skin side up for another 20 minutes.
